πŸ₯˜ Ingredients

13 items
  • 2 pieces chicken breasts
  • 3 tablespoons honey
  • 2 teaspoons Dijon mustard
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 4 cups mixed salad greens
  • 1 cup cherry tomatoes
  • 1 medium cucumber
  • 0.5 medium red onion
  • 0.25 cup sliced almonds
  • 2 tablespoons balsamic vinegar
  • 0.5 teaspoon salt
  • 0.25 teaspoon black pepper

πŸ“ Instructions

9 steps
1

Start by preparing the honey glaze for the chicken. In a small bowl, combine 2 tablespoons of honey, 1 teaspoon of Dijon mustard, 1 teaspoon of garlic powder, 0.25 teaspoon of salt, and 0.25 teaspoon of black pepper. Mix well.

2

Heat 1 tablespoon of olive oil in a skillet over medium heat. While the skillet heats, pat the chicken breasts dry with a paper towel and season them lightly with salt and pepper on both sides.

3

Place the chicken breasts in the hot skillet and cook for 5-6 minutes on one side without moving them, until a golden crust develops. Flip the chicken breasts and cook for another 5-6 minutes, or until the internal temperature reaches 165Β°F (74Β°C).

4

Reduce the heat to low, add the honey glaze to the skillet, and gently coat the chicken by spooning the glaze over it. Cook for 1-2 more minutes. Remove the chicken from the skillet and let it rest for 5 minutes before slicing into thin strips.

5

While the chicken cools, prepare the salad base. In a large bowl, combine 4 cups of mixed salad greens, 1 cup of halved cherry tomatoes, 1 medium cucumber sliced thin, and 0.5 medium red onion sliced thinly.

6

In a small bowl, whisk together 1 tablespoon of honey, 1 teaspoon of Dijon mustard, 2 tablespoons of balsamic vinegar, and 1 tablespoon of olive oil until emulsified. Season the dressing with a pinch of salt and pepper to taste.

7

Drizzle the dressing over the salad and toss gently to combine.

8

Top the salad with the sliced honey-glazed chicken and sprinkle 0.25 cup of sliced almonds over the top.

9

Serve immediately and enjoy your fresh and delicious Honey Chicken Salad!
